Budget Turkey Tetrazzini

My riff on Cooking Light's recipe, reflecting what was in my pantry and personal taste (peas--ick!).


Cost breakdown:

$0.20 mushrooms
$0.65 pasta
$0.37 milk
$0.16 green beans
$0.71 2 triangles of name brand spreadable swiss cheese
$1.00 zucchini
$0.30 neufchatel
$0.30 flaxseed tortilla chips
Unknown--3 or so tablespoons of rally old peccorino-romano cheese; 1 onion (bagged); 3 tablespoons of flour; leftover Thanksgiving turkey free courtesy of my friend Deb, who received it at her grocery store but uses an organic turkey for her family and didn't want it (which was wonderful since I was laid off days before Thanksgiving); dash of ground thyme.

I estimate the six servings of this dish total approximately $4. Living beautifully on a budget, indeed. Feeling super virtuous and thrifty right now. Go me.
